Overview

""This is only until you're safe,"" he said. ""And what happens if I want more?"" Jonah McAllister lives for duty alone. Orphaned at a young age, he became a father to his brothers before he had the chance to be anything else, shaping his life around survival and sacrifice instead of dreams-or love. Until the night she collapses on his land. Fleeing with the nephew she has sworn to protect, Katherine Wilkes arrives at the McAllister ranch soaked. Quiet but determined, she brings warmth and order into a home long ruled by obligation-and stirs feelings Jonah believed he had lost. ""You're safe here,"" he said. ""Then don't ask me to leave."" But safety is fragile. As whispers begin to circulate and her nephews' abusive father closes in, Jonah makes a choice that binds their lives together in a marriage of convenience.
